Artist Statement
This composition expresses the tension between vulnerability and strength. The color palette of sepia, tan, dust gray, and faded blue evokes a sense of faded memory and longing. The central saturation creates a dynamic that embodies strength, while the contrasting lighter border represents vulnerability. Dots, symbolizing vulnerability, clash with the static blocks of strength, primarily dominating the central area, creating a gradient tension at the edges where the two emotions collide. Broken pixels act as intentional disruptions, suggesting scars or faults in the facade of strength. The layout is dense at the center with echoes of open space around, creating a balance that resonates with the given seed.
